Output 5259402c8c69fb10a5bbcf7df9a8034f619535fe2f8c48a35a97b6c95bed1c1b:4

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886eb75f46623a2c0a72689f205f65fd03d90122 OP_EQUAL
address
3E8QTLSEqTKdRRgZkYhvLmeLEogiRFw36H
transaction
5259402c8c69fb10a5bbcf7df9a8034f619535fe2f8c48a35a97b6c95bed1c1b
spent
true